From 1759f84c2a8c3dfd2705a2059754c4d0f1f8ca4b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Vineet Gupta Date: Thu, 14 Mar 2013 17:51:24 +0530 Subject: leek: if lseek syscall is not available, use lseek64 even for !LFS With Busybox and uClibc - both built w/o LFS, this caused ash to be completely broken, as lseek was simply returning error.
